
West Point Cadet, M4 Rifle Go Missing from Campus
The search continues for a West Point cadet who has gone missing from the campus and possibly armed.
According to the Army Times, both military police and the New York State Police are currently searching for a West Point cadet who has been believed to be missing since Saturday morning. It was reported that he was last seen on Friday evening. The search continued through Sunday with no luck in finding the cadet who is set to graduate in 2021.
To add to the concern, an M4 rifle was also reported to be missing from the campus as well. However, there is no evidence that he has a magazine or ammunition to fire rifle.
The cadet is believed to not be a threat to others but maybe to himself.
West Point has heightened its security but is operating under normal practices.
